Parliamentary Energy proposes new legislation for oil and gas
 
12:26: 10/10/2015

 

nauty-kurd-020412b.jpg

 

Khandan - announced for the Oil and Energy Committee in the Iraqi Council of Representatives, said that there is a tendency for the Commission to move to draft a new proposal for the oil and gas law in case the federal government delayed sending a draft oil and gas law, which decided to withdraw it from the House of Representatives.

Said committee member Zahir al-Abadi, that "the Commission will proceed to formulate a proposed new law on oil and gas in the case of the federal government delayed sending the bill, which has decided to withdraw it from parliament along with 55 other bill."

Abadi said in remarks to the Iraqi Media Network that "the Commission will begin early next legislative term of the proposed law drafted and presented to the Parliament to pass and the resolution of the oil between Baghdad and the Kurdistan region and the differences between the provinces own."

Since the adoption of the Iraqi constitution, such as oil and gas law, the most prominent outstanding issues between Baghdad and Erbil were unable to former House and present to find consensus on a common formula for the oil and gas law.
